My LIF Untilites for Linux distribution contains scheamtics and software for an interface between a parallel printer port and an HP41 barcode wand (which you have to modify by soldering an opto-isolator to 2 of the wires between the wand and the HP41 module).
The interface takes care of all the timing of the 'barcode' data, so this should work with any machinewith a parallel port. There's software for luinux to transfer HP41 programs and data files (but only 'normal' numbers and text strings), provided as C source code. It shouldn't be too hard to port it.
